Adafruit raspberry pi lesson 13 pdf

Introduction this is the chapter web page to support the content in chapter 1 of the book. The great advantage of connecting this way is that it can even supply the power for your pi and you do not need keyboard, mouse or display attached to the pi to log into it. Raspberry pi stack exchange is a question and answer site for users and developers of hardware and software for raspberry pi. If you have a running raspberry pi with an up to date copy of raspbian you can simply run the following command to install adafruit blinka. Preparing an sd card for your raspberry pi simon monk.

Starter kit for rpi introduction wiringpi wiringpi is a pin based gpio access library written in c for the bcm2835 used in the raspberry pi. The powerswitch tail 2 from adafruit, looks like a 110v electrical lead with a box in the middle. Instead of asking the pi linux kernel to send these signals, pop on this handy hat. The complete guide to enabling speech recognition on an rpi3 in nodejs. Adafruit industries, essential service and business.

It uses the standard 9 pin connector found on most tncs and trackers so the same radiospecific. If you follow the below steps closely, you should be able to read the humidity and temperature data off your am2315. Whether youre a fan of the easilyreadable, interpretive scripting language python or more of a diehard c programmer, youll find a programming option that suits our needs. The box is actually an optoisolated solidstate relay.

Getting started with the raspberry pi set up your raspberry pi and explore what it can do. Kivypie integrates all software needed and boots directly on the raspberry pi, no extra configuration is needed. If you have a running raspberry pi with an up to date copy of raspbian you can simply run the following command to install adafruitblinka. Uncover the pir sensor and you should see a message saying power on and the little led on the powerswitch tail should light, then turn itself off after 20 seconds. This lesson has been designed as an introduction to the raspberry pi. For that purpose in this project im using raspberry pi which acting as a dsp digital signal processing. The raspberry pi is a wonderful little computer, but one thing it isnt very good at is controlling dc servo motors these motors need very specific and repetitive timing pulses to set the position. Teach, learn, and make with raspberry pi raspberry pi. The onboard pwm controller will drive all 16 channels simultaneously with no additional raspberry pi. To build the project described in this lesson, you will need the following parts.

The raspberry pi can make a great home automation controller. Ive been looking at the adafruit learning lesson arduino lesson, which touches on speed control of a dc motor using arduino. Know the basic architectures of a computing device. See circuitpython libraries on raspberry pi to get a fresh raspberry pi setup. Your sd card is ready for use in your raspberry pi. Live stream to introducing bluetooth low energy and how to compile and use bluez on the raspberry pi. In this lesson you will learn how to remote control your raspberry pi over your local network using secure shell ssh. If youve never driven an led or read in a button press using the raspberry pi, this tutorial should help to get you started. Interface circuit with a timer to limit transmission time. Overview one of the great things about the raspberry pi is that it has a gpio connector to which you can attach external hardware. First time configuration set up your raspberry pi for the first time overview using the whole sd card using the whole.

In this lesson you will learn how to remote control your raspberry pi with a console cable. The kit is designed for any raspberry pi version 1 and 2. A common reason for remote controlling your pi from another computer is that you may be using your pi solely to control some electronics and therefore not need a keyboard, mouse and monitor, other than for setting it up. Adafruit products and arduino for stem science, technology, engineering and mathematics. Getting started with raspberry pi teaching resources. Overview the raspberry pi and beaglebone black include support for python, which makes it easy to get access to a lot of lowlevel hardware and software stacks usb, tcpip, multiple file. In this lesson, you will combine the pir sensor from lesson 12 with the powerswitch tail 2 module from adafruit, to automatically switch something on when movement is detected. Even if your pi came with an sd card with an operating system on, it is a good idea to update it to the latest version, as improvements and bug fixes are going in all the time. Contribute to richardchambersraspberrypi development by creating an account on github. When you load any of our guides, and click on the download pdf link in the left sidebar, our. The software is exactly the same on all 40pin and 20pin raspberry pi models. This light was originally labelled ok but has been renamed to act on the revision 2 raspberry pi boards. In this lesson, you will combine the pir sensor from lesson 12 with the powerswitch tail 2 module from adafruit, to automatically switch something on when.

In this chapter, you are introduced to the raspberry pi rpi platform hardware. Download pdf guides from the adafruit learning system. Using the bmp085180 with raspberry pi or beaglebone black. The raspberry pi development community is very fluid. Overview in this lesson, you will learn how to use the digital inputs on the gpio connector with a door sensor and a pir motion detector. This lesson shows you how to create an sd card for your raspberry pi. Prototype with raspberry pi internet of things 101. When i look at it in the pc device manager, there is a. Based on my desire to make a multiple guitar effect, a guitar effect is an instrument that can change the output signal from guitar. In lesson we will build on this security sensing to have the pi use a digital output to control the power to an electrical appliance when movement is detected. Stepper motors created by simon monk last updated on 20190327 08.

The sd card is important because this is where the raspberry pi keeps its operating system and is also where you will store your documents and programs. Ds18b20 temperature sensing created by simon monk last updated on 20140507 06. Connections to speaker and microphone jack of transceiver. Network setup created by simon monk last updated on 201106 11. This is lesson in the learn arduino adafruit series. The adafruit 16channel 12bit pwmservo hat or bonnet will drive up to 16 servos or pwm outputs over i2c with only 2 pins. I have a raspberry pi and i was wondering if there was a way to make the gpio pins control a dc motor in both directions. Is it possible to instead use a 12v motor via an external power supply to the motor. It could be taught as a standalone lesson, as a workshop, or as part of a wider scheme of work to introduce students to raspberry pi and explain its main features and setup. That sounded pretty good to me, so i flashed it to an sd card and booted it on one of the growing number of raspberry pis sitting around my house. When you buy a raspberry pi, it may or may not be sold with an sd card. One of the great things about the raspberry pi is that it has a gpio. In this lesson, you will learn how to control a small dc motor using an arduino and a transistor.

In this lesson, we will concentrate on sensing movement and activation of the door switch. Be sure to check out our posts, tutorials and new raspberry pi related products. In the example, it indicates that the motor used is 6v. The ok01 lesson contains an explanation about how to get started and teaches how to enable the ok or act led on the raspberry pi board near the rca and usb ports. If you want plug in a cobbler or gertboard at the same time, check out our stacking header, you can fit an. It results in a gpio pin change on header the p5 is gone and a modified setup for i2s different pinmux.

679 1245 1596 1026 863 128 894 474 1054 372 57 1069 1469 1004 384 346 1422 1607 1342 144 973 790 1493 72 781 36 572 1537 1120 976 311 1279 302 691 945 1140 1369 802 1350 839 1278